What type of system do you have? Researching your problem, this error most often occurs with an incompatible video card, or a video card that doesn't meet the minimum specs. If you have dual video cards, like an onboard intel video card and a discrete GPU, the game could be sensing the intel card instead and throwing the error.

I'm receiving a crash dump error
There can be different scenarios for receiving this error. First, be sure that you have the minimum specs required -- we've seen a lot of reports of this occurring with some laptops and other computer that do not contain at least the minimum specs. Also be sure to download the Iatest patch. This has resolved the issue for users playing in territories such as Japan, Bahrain, Kuwait, Lebanon, Oman, Qatar, and Saudi Arabia.
• If you have hardware that meets minimum specs, but you have out of date drivers, please update your drivers and restart the game to see if that helps.
• If your hardware meets the minimum specs and your drivers are current, try to disable async compute from the advanced graphics options settings.
• Run the game in safe mode or exit the game, delete the config file and restart the title (config file lives here: C:\Users\Username\Saved Games\MachineGames\Wolfenstein II The New Colossus\base\Wolfenstein II The New ColossusConfig.local)
• Close down all applications running in the background
• If you have a supported i5 or i7 CPU, exit the title, disable igpu before playing again

If you continue to encounter any issues, please contact our support team and provide your dxdiag so we can work to troubleshoot further.

Set Your Primary GPU and Power Settings

If your machine has multiple GPUs (such as many laptops), you should ensure your video driver is selecting the correct GPU for Wolfenstein II: The New Colossus by opening either the NVIDIA Control Panel or AMD Catalyst Control Panel and ensuring that Wolfenstein II: The New Colossusx64.exe is making use of your primary GPU.

You can find instructions for your relevant graphics card manufacturer here:

AMD http://support.amd.com/en-us/download

NVIDIA http://www.geforce.com/geforce-experience


Power saving features will sometimes override high-performance profiles to save battery life. When the computer attempts to save battery life, it will switch to the integrated card because it does not require as many resources to run.



You can resolve this by following the process below:

Press the Battery icon in the notification area of your taskbar.
Select More power options... and then expand the Show additional plans section.

Select High performance and then close the window.
Plug in your power cable to ensure that your battery does not run low while playing.

I have a pretty solid rig which meets all the requirements and drivers, but I was still receiving the Crash Dump error as well. I set the game to run in Windows 8 compatability mode, and voila, running no issues. So, maybe give that a go.
